California's business climate ranks a below-average No. 30 nationally, reflecting significant executive criticism stemming from its pro-consumer policies and tax burdens.
The Tax Foundation indicated California ranks third-worst for business taxation, following New Jersey and New York, highlighting the significant financial burden faced by corporations.
US News placed California fourth-worst in terms of economic and opportunity scores, underscoring the challenges the state poses for businesses seeking a favorable environment.
In the Rich States/Poor States report, California's average rank was ninth-lowest, suggesting its economic performance and business climate are not competitive compared to others.
